Comparing softside duffels and hardside rollers

The debate between softside bags and hardside spinners often comes down to the specific requirements of your trip. Softside bags, like leather or nylon duffels, are typically the most versatile luggage because they can be compressed to fit into tight spaces like regional jet overhead bins or crowded car trunks. They also tend to have more external pockets for quick access items. Hardside luggage, on the other hand, offers superior protection for fragile items and often features 360 degree spinner wheels for effortless movement through flat surfaces.

If your weekend getaway involves frequent walking through city streets or using public transit, a nimble softside bag is often preferred. However, if you are checking a bag for a longer stay, a durable hardshell like the Samsonite Freeform Large Spinner provides 112.5 liters of capacity. This model uses a polypropylene shell that is pliable and lightweight, making it easier to stay under airline weight limits. While it is a no-frills option, its expandable design offers the extra room needed for souvenirs or additional layers for cold weather trips.

Maximizing space with internal organization systems

Organization is where the most versatile luggage proves its worth. A well designed interior allows you to separate clean clothes from dirty laundry and formal attire from casual gear. The Travelpro Platinum Elite Medium Check-In Spinner includes a built-in garment folder with a removable folding board. This feature is invaluable for travelers who need to keep suits or dresses wrinkle free without carrying a second bag. Its height-adjustable handle and magnetically locking wheels make it surprisingly nimble for a checked suitcase.

For those who prefer a more structured packing experience, the Briggs & Riley Baseline Medium Expandable Spinner is widely regarded as offering one of the best packing experiences available. It can fit an additional week of clothing when fully compressed, providing a massive amount of storage in a relatively compact footprint. Most Versatile Luggage FAQs

What defines the most versatile luggage?
Versatile luggage is defined by its ability to adapt to different trip lengths and environments. It typically features multiple carry options, such as handles and shoulder straps, and modular internal organization that works for both casual and professional attire.
Is a duffel bag or a roller suitcase more versatile?
Duffel bags are often considered more versatile for weekend trips because they are compressible and easier to fit into varied storage spaces like car trunks or regional jet overhead bins. Roller suitcases are better for long terminal walks and protecting fragile items.
What is the best material for luggage durability?
For hardside luggage, 100% polycarbonate offers the best balance of being lightweight and impact resistant. For softside luggage, high denier nylon or premium leather provide excellent durability and a professional aesthetic.
Can I use a weekend duffel for a business trip?
Yes, provided it has a professional design. The most versatile luggage options, like leather duffels, are specifically designed to transition from business meetings to casual getaways while keeping items like suits wrinkle free.
What size luggage do I need for a 3 day weekend?
A bag with a capacity of 40 to 50 liters is usually sufficient for a 3 day weekend. This size allows you to pack several outfits and a pair of shoes while still fitting within most airline carry on dimensions.
